
WAI 17782N Starter
Starter for Saab 9-3 and 9-5
WAI 17782N is a 12-volt starter built for Saab applications that need a Bosch-family, permanent magnet gear reduction design. It is a 100% new unit, not remanufactured, and is engineered to deliver the amp output required for modern starting systems.
Compatible With 2003 Saab 9-3, Bosch Unit, and 1999-2001 Saab 9-3 and 1999-2001 Saab 9-5 Bosch Unit applications. The WAI 17782N starter is a direct-fit electrical starting component for these Saab models.
- 12-volt starter for automotive starting systems
- Permanent magnet gear reduction design for efficient cranking
- Bosch family configuration
- 1.4 power rating
- Clockwise (right) rotation
- 9-tooth drive
- Flange mounting type

Installation Notes and Tips
Verify the vehicle’s starter configuration before installation, including 12-volt system requirements, clockwise rotation, 9-tooth drive count, and flange mounting style. Confirm Bosch unit fitment on the vehicle before replacing the starter. Inspect battery condition, cable connections, and charging system output during diagnosis to avoid repeat starting problems.
